I'm checking to see if the DPFE is the cause of an P0401 CEL. I probed the brown wire with a white tracer and had my ground on the battery ground. I saw 5 volts and when I applied vacuum to the EGR the engine died and the voltage didn't change. Did I check the appropriate wire for voltage?
 






With a scanner hooked up and watching live data the voltage should be right at .9 volts + or - a few tenths at idle. With a vacuum hand pump attached to the egr valve when you open the valve with the pump the voltage should climb and the engine stumble, The max voltage is 5 volts but the engine will stall before it gets to that point at idle. If you are seeing 5 volts at idle then the DPFE sensor is bad.
